Job summary
The Medical Resourcing and Medical Staffing Teams are part of the Human Resources Department and provides a support functionfor all Medical and Dental recruitment for the organisation on recruitment , retention issues, Rota's and managaing the Medical Locum Bank. This apprenticeship offers a unique and diverse opportunity to develop a full range of skills in these areas with teams that possess a wealth of knowledge, talent and expertise
Standard - Recruitment Resourcer Level 2
Duration - 15 months
Provider - GLP Training
Main duties of the job
The successful applicant will be responsible for customer service duties, taking enquiries from managers, staffand visitors to theCustomer interactions will cover a wide range of situations including; face-to-face, telephone, post, and email. You will also play an important administrative role within the team, completing a variety of clerical tasks in a timely manner, in order to support the team.
